Output 93fd80cd4eedbc87da77976facaddb22ccdfc58108d22181a5ffa316791b260a:2

value
12287831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b92feee3fb7078aa70d3b286a0d0f0e2cb5e7cb OP_EQUAL
address
MLdAFYUQCVuSc71iuk1m9t1MsAQSNgM8Uj
transaction
93fd80cd4eedbc87da77976facaddb22ccdfc58108d22181a5ffa316791b260a
spent
true